So I do call to witness what ye see, 38 And what ye see not, 39 that this is the speech of an honourable Messenger, 40 And it is not the speech of a poet; how little do you believe! 41 Nor the word of a soothsayer; little do you remember. 42 [It is] a revelation from the Lord of the worlds. 43 And if he (Muhammad SAW) had forged a false saying concerning Us (Allah), 44 We would have definitely taken revenge from him. 45 And then certainly should have cut off his life artery (Aorta), 46 and none of you could have saved him! 47 Surely it is a Reminder to the godfearing; 48 We certainly know that some among you do deny it. 49 Surely it is a sorrow to the unbelievers; 50 it is the indubitable truth. 51 Extol, then the limitless glory of thy Sustainer's mighty name! 52
Allah Almighty has spoken the truth.
End of Surah: Incontestable (Al-Haaqqah). Sent down in Mecca after Kingship (Al-Mulk) before The Heights (Al-Ma'aarej)
